Locating the Perfect Rental for Your Needs

Securing the ideal rental can be a challenging task. With so many choices available, it's common to become overwhelmed. However, by following certain key steps and considering their individual needs, you can reduce down the perfect rental property.
First, determine your financial limitations. This will help eliminate any rentals that are beyond your price range. Next, make a compilation of your must-have amenities, such as the number of bedrooms and bathrooms, cleaning facilities, and garage.
When you have a clear grasp of your needs and budget, begin your search. There are several online platforms available to help you find rentals in your locality. Don't hesitate to speak with landlords or property managers personally to schedule viewings.
When viewing a potential rental, take close attention to the condition of the unit, as well as the surroundings. Ask questions about amenities and lease terms. By taking your time and performing your due diligence, you can boost your chances of finding the perfect rental for your needs.

Understanding Tenant Rights and Responsibilities
As a tenant, understanding your rights and responsibilities is essential for a positive renting situation.
Initially, familiarize yourself with the legal structure governing tenant-landlord interactions in your jurisdiction. This often includes provincial laws and ordinances that outline standards for both parties.
Furthermore, review your lease agreement thoroughly. It serves as a formal contract that outlines the terms of your tenancy, including rent schedule, maintenance obligations, and allowable uses for the property.
Comprehend that tenants have certain rights, such as the right to a livable dwelling free from dangerous conditions, the right to privacy within their unit, and the right to just treatment by landlords. Conversely, tenants also have responsibilities, including paying rent on time, maintaining the property in good condition, and observing the terms of the lease agreement.
Open conversation between tenants and landlords is crucial for addressing any potential disputes that may arise.
